Caption: Stipple engraving by Ridley, after an original miniature copied from The Naval Chronicle Vol 12, Plate 155, published by J. Gold, London, 1804. Isaac Coffin: Born in Boston, entered the Royal Navy 1773. Lieutenant, 1778. Commander, 1781. Captain, 1782. Rear Admiral, 1804. Vice Admiral, 1808. Admiral, 1814. Served off North America 1773-79, as a junior officer and as CO of H.M. cutter PLACENTIA. and H.M. armed ship PINSON. He commanded other ships until 1794. From 1794 to 1808, when his active duty ceased, Coffin served ably in several administrative posts.
